Audi Q6 e-tron and SQ6 e-tron: Bridging the Gap with Electrified Performance

In Audi’s ongoing pursuit of electrification, the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ron and the 2025 Audi SQ6 e-tron emerge as pivotal players in their expanding electric vehicle portfolio. Positioned between the compact Q4 and the commanding Q8 e-trons, these latest models strive to deliver a harmonious blend of luxury, performance, and cutting-edge technology.

Performance Specifications

Both quattro variants of these SUVs are set to debut in the U.S. market, boasting power figures that outshine their global counterparts. The standard Q6 e-tron quattro packs a punch with up to 456 horsepower when launch control kicks in, while its sportier sibling, the SQ6 e-tron, ramps up the excitement with a heart-pounding 510 horsepower under similar conditions.

Acceleration is where these models truly shine; the Q6 leaps from 0 to 60 mph in a mere 5 seconds when launch control is engaged, while the SQ6 slashes nearly a second off that time, clocking in at around 4.2 seconds. Though both models have electronically limited top speeds—130 mph for the Q6 and a slightly higher 143 mph for the SQ6—they promise thrilling driving experiences.

When it comes to range—an essential factor for EV enthusiasts—the standard Q6 is anticipated to exceed 300 miles on a single charge, as per preliminary EPA estimates. Details on the SQ6’s range are expected to emerge later this year.

Charging Capabilities

Modern EVs rely heavily on rapid charging infrastructure, and in this aspect, both models excel. They are equipped to handle DC Fast Charging at 270 kW with an 800-volt system, allowing drivers to recharge their batteries from 10% to 80% in approximately twenty-one minutes—a quick pit stop before hitting the road again.

Pricing & Availability

While the final pricing for the Audi Q6 e-tron and SQ6 e-tron is yet to be announced closer to their sale dates later this year, European prices provide a glimpse of what consumers might anticipate. Initial figures suggest starting prices around €74,700 for the base model, with costs ascending to approximately €93,800 for premium trims like those offered in the SQ variant.
